By Isha Trivedi '19

Although most students here at ND have gotten used to the rush and camaraderie of attending classes in high school, potential members of the incoming Class of 2022 freshmen hadn't had that opportunity until last week. On November 10th, eighth graders from a multitude of different schools visited the ND campus for Eighth Grade Day and experienced a day in the life of a high school student on a bustling, thriving urban campus.

Students had the opportunity to attend “mini classes” in each department, ate lunch (an integral part of attending ND) and learned about all the various clubs and organizations on campus. The Class of 2020 Griffins, the future big sisters to these eighth graders, put into practice the leadership skills they have been learning all year in a variety of ways, from being small group leaders to classroom coordinators to helping with the rally.

We look forward to having many of the 8th graders who joined us for this special day join us as members of the Class of 2022 next fall!
